Jeffrey L. Kindler, 68, of Nevada passed away at home on Monday, February 2, 2026.
Born May 11, 1957, in Galion. He attended Colonel Crawford High School and went to Camp Lajeune in the fall to join the Marines. He married his love of his life, Jackie Snow, on February 12, 2003, and she survives in Nevada.
Jeff worked at Blackhawk in Upper Sandusky, which is where he met Jackie. He went on to work at Whirlpool in Marion, until his retirement.
He loved his OSU team, his Marines and his family. Jeff also loved to go fishing with his grandkids and his buddy Ron.
He will be dearly missed by his wife Jackie, his mother Joan (Frank) Johnson Wilfing Kindler, his children: Jeremy (Erika) Kindler, Nicholas (Danica) Kindler, Becky (Jay) Wolbers, and step kids: Nicole Banks, Michelle, Tylor, Alex, Erin and Peyton, and siblings: Tim (Carol) Kindler, Melinda (Doug) Walter, along with nephews and nieces.
Jeff was preceded in death by his father Edwin Kindler, step son Joshua, brother Michael Kindler and Stepdad Robert (Bob) Wilfing.
A Celebration of Life Gathering to be held on Saturday, April 18, from 11:00 am to 2:00 pm at the Ark Church located at 200 Gelsanliter Rd., Galion Ohio, with Pastor Jeff Shaull officiating.
Memorial contributions may be made to Hospice of Wyandot Memorial, and can be sent to Lucas-Batton, 476 S. Sandusky Ave. Upper Sandusky, OH 43351.
